Access Education Budgets – Account Coding Mandatory

We have introduced a new setting which makes it possible to make Account Coding mandatory, ensuring no account codes are missed within the budget for reporting and exporting the budget to Access Education Finance or a Finance third party.

To make account coding mandatory, navigate to School/Academy, Other Settings, expand School Settings and select 'Account Coding Mandatory'.

The 'Ref' codes that are in use will be listed to select which of these are required to be mandatory before saving.

When adding or editing a Job Type, the mandatory fields are indicated with a * and an error will occur to advise these fields are required before being able to Save.


In a Scenario and GAG Income\Section 251, when editing the coding on a budget line or editing the coding in bulk for the IE Section the mandatory fields are indicated with a * and an error will occur to advise these fields are required before being able to Save

.

When adding or editing a budget line and linked budget line in Non-GAG income\Section 251, Other Expenditure and Capital, the mandatory fields are indicated and an error will occur to advise these fields are required before able to Save.

When loading a Staff Contract, a message is displayed if mandatory account codes are required and no changes can be made to the staff contract until mandatory codes are completed which are indicated with a * on Account Coding tab.



Access Education Central Budgets – Grouped Budget Report

Under Financial Reports in Central Budgets, a new Grouped Budget report displays key information about published budgets in selected schools, avoiding the need to run multiple reports to get the information required.


Access Education ICFP – Deployed Showing Contact and Non-Contact

On Staff Load, the Deployed column now shows the split between Contact and Non-Contact Codes, providing visibility of the different ways in which staff members spend their time.


Access Education ICFP – Display Pupil Numbers

On Resource Requirements, the Pupil Numbers in the linked Scenario are now easily visible by clicking View Pupil Numbers. This saves time having to switch back to Access Education Budgets to look up this information in the Scenario.


Access Education Budgets – Pupil Numbers

Within Scenario and Pupil Numbers, the Edit Pupil Numbers column heading has been changed from 'Oct Year' to 'Budget Year'.

Whilst the pupil numbers are still sourced from the October census of the previous year, the column heading now displays 'Budget Year' to maintain consistency across the software. This reflects the budget year within which these pupil numbers are being calculated and applied.
